Mehmet Karabela Hosts Leonard Cohen Event Covered in The Queen's University Journal

From the article:

"A legendary Canadian singer-songwriter was honoured for his lyricism and flair at a recent event.

Hosted by academic Mehmet Karabela and the department of Jewish studies on March 13, the event started with a short introduction video giving the audience a taste of Leonard Cohen’s personality by showing him onstage presenting his poetry. The video included anecdotes from Suzanne Verdal, the muse of one of Leonard Cohen’s most touching songs, “Suzanne.”

After briefing the audience, Karabela introduced Ottawa-based singer and pianist Kimberley Dunn. She was joined by a Cellist Greg Weeks and Kyle Briscoe, who represented Leonard Cohen’s ties to McGill."
